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| green boring sponge | Indian Pangolin |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Porifera (Sponges)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Demospongiae (Demospongiae)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Clionaida (Clionaida) | Pholidota (Pholidota) |
| Family | Clionaidae | Manidae |
| Genus | Cliona | Manis |
| Species | Cliona viridis | Manis crassicaudata |
